Meet will be at Sandgate Beach, Arthur Davies Park, Flinders Parade, between 7th & 8th Avenue, Sandgate. It is right next to the Sandgate swimming pool. There is a toilet block, BBQs, taps, drinking fountains & shower there, with a fish & chips/coffee shop 50m across the road.
You will also see the Surf Connect's school's van (with big wind & kitesurfing graphics) and flags flying at the park. Park anywhere along the main road there. For those bringing gear to the gearswap, lay your gear on the grass in the park and please keep pathway clear as we have a lot of families and disabled people walking and jogging at the seafront. Council's permit for the meet is for 11-3pm. Please make sure no rubbish is left behind the area.
High tide is 2.15pm on the day so get your gear ready and you can sail right off the beach there. Best time to sail would be an hour or two before and upto 2 hours after high tide there. As the tide goes out, watch the sandbanks! The area is extremely safe, no jellies around at present, no rocks, you dont even need booties! We havent started wearing wetties yet but its close. First aid station and rescue boat will be on standby.

Including the kiters, i think we managed around 25 people all up. was a longboard kind of day, light winds and clear blue skies. great weather.
out on the water was the sup, starboard phantom and one design. the kiter guys went skurfing out off the beach. On the land a few of us tried the landboards and mucked around with the batwing setup. the gear swap saw some real bargains if you needed a new sail.
In the end we held off with the bbq as most headed off early due to the light winds.
